TDP chief Chandrababu Naidu arrested in corruption case: ‘Asked for evidence, CID refused to show’

In the early hours of Saturday, a team of police officials reached the area to take Naidu in custody. Former Andhra Pradesh chief minister N Chandrababu Naidu was arrested by the state’s Criminal Investigation Department (CID) on Saturday early in the morning over allegations of corruption.

The Telugu Desam Party (TDP) chief alleged that the sleuths arrested him without any proper information and that they refused to show him evidence.

“I did not commit any malpractice or corruption. CID arrested me without any proper information and I asked them to show the evidence but they refused to show and attached my name to  the FIR without my role,” Naidu was quoted as saying by news agency ANI before he was taken in custody in Nandyal district.

According to an official, the TDP leader was arrested by the Andhra Pradesh Criminal Investigation Department (CID) around 6 am from R K Function Hall at Gnanapuram.

Earlier today, he was served an arrest warrant by the CID in connection with the alleged corruption charges, news agency ANI reported.

In the early hours of Saturday, a team of police officials reached the area to take Naidu in custody. However, they could not proceed as a group of TDP workers got into an argument with the policemen questioning the late-night action.

Leaders of the party condemned the late-night police action against the senior leader. Some of the party workers have also been detained by the police,  ANI reported.

As per the TDP leader’s counsel, they will approach the High Court as well for Naidu’s bail. “CID has taken Chandrababu for a medical check-up after high blood pressure and diabetes were detected. We are approaching the High Court for bail,” Naidu’s counsel was quoted as saying by ANI.

The former chief minister has been arrested under relevant IPC sections, including Sections 120B (criminal conspiracy), 420 (cheating and dishonestly inducing delivery of property) and 465 (forgery), according to a notice served to Naidu. The Andhra Pradesh CID has also invoked the Prevention of Corruption Act against him.

In the notice, the Deputy Superintendent of Police of the CID’s Economic Offences Wing (EOW), M Dhanunjayudu, said, “It is to inform you that you have been arrested… at 6 am at R K Function Hall, Gnanapuram, H/o Moolasagaram, Nandyala town and it is a non-bailable offence.”
